November 3 (SeeNews) - Macedonian building materials producer Cementarnica Usje [MSE:USJE] said its net profit fell by an annual 10% to 865.9 million denars ($16.4 million/14.1 million euro) in the nine months through September.
The company's operating revenue rose 3% year-on-year to 3.44 billion denars in the January-September period, Cementarnica Usje said in a bourse filing on Thursday.
Operating expenses increased 8% on the year to 2.46 billion denars in the period under review.
The company’s financial revenue rose by an annual 14% to 19.1 million denars, while financial expenses rose to 8.5 million denars in the first nine months of 2017 from 1.5 million denars a year earlier.
Cementarnica Usje is a subsidiary of Greece-based cement producer Titan, which owns production plants in nine countries and employs more than 5,500 people worldwide.
(1 euro = 61.54 denars)
